E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
unittest参数化
Pytest中fixture的几种用法
本篇主要讲解fixture的几种常用用法,均来源自how-to-fixtures二、fixture
参数化
pytest中常见的
参数化
方法,如@pytest.mark.parametrize装饰器形式的。
梓沫1119
·
2024-02-02 12:42
Python
框架
软件测试
pytest
服务器
python
python技术栈之单元测试中mock的使用
unittest
是python内置的单元测试库,在做接口测试时,如果开发的接口未开发出来,我们如果想要测试接口联调,又不能干等着,这时可以使用
unittest
.mock模拟接口
咖啡加剁椒..
·
2024-02-02 08:41
软件测试
python
单元测试
log4j
功能测试
软件测试
自动化测试
程序人生
Python+request+
unittest
实现接口测试框架集成实例
1、为什么要写代码实现接口自动化大家知道很多接口测试工具可以实现对接口的测试,如postman、jmeter、fiddler等等,而且使用方便,那么为什么还要写代码实现接口自动化呢?工具虽然方便,但也不足之处:测试数据不可控制接口测试本质是对数据的测试,调用接口,输入一些数据,随后,接口返回一些数据。验证接口返回数据的正确性。在用工具运行测试用例之前不得不手动向数据库中插入测试数据。这样我们的接口
蜀山客e
·
2024-02-02 07:31
Python测试框架 Pytest —— mock使用(pytest-mock)
pytest-mock安装:pipinstallpytest-mock这里的mock和
unittest
的mock基本上都是一样的,唯一的区别在于pytest.mock需要导入mock对象的详细路径。
.咖啡加剁椒
·
2024-02-02 07:18
软件测试
python
pytest
压力测试
功能测试
软件测试
自动化测试
程序人生
unittest
学习(1)-TestSuite类详解
、通过
unittest
.TestSuite()类直接构建,或者通过TestSuite实例的addTests、addTest方法构建import
unittest
classUserCase(
unittest
.TestCase
神大人_d11c
·
2024-02-02 07:02
测试驱动技术(TDD)系列之4:详解java操控excel的核心api
在前面的文章讲解利用TestNG进行数据驱动:测试驱动技术(TDD)系列之2:详解TestNG
参数化
测试数据格式展示如下(junit4也类似):@DataProviderpublicObject[][]
测试开发Kevin
·
2024-02-02 02:18
一文8个步骤从0到1实现Python+Selenium自动化测试项目实战【建议收藏】
目录第1章、自动化测试第2章、Python基础第3章、元素定位方式第4章、元素|浏览器操作方法第5章、元素等待第6章、鼠标和键盘操作第7章、
UnitTest
+PyTest第8章、项目实战并自动发送测试报告邮件
小码哥说测试
·
2024-02-02 01:16
自动化测试
软件测试
python
selenium
开发语言
自动化测试
测试工程师
python自动化测试框架
unittest
与pytest的区别
有使用过
unittest
单元测试框架,再使用pytest单元测试框架,就可以明显感觉到pytest比
unittest
真的简洁、方便很多。
咖 啡加剁椒
·
2024-02-02 01:43
软件测试
python
pytest
开发语言
软件测试
功能测试
自动化测试
程序人生
python+selenium自动化测试项目实战
说明:本项目采用流程控制思想,未引用
unittest
&pytest等单元测试框架一.项目介绍目的测试某官方网站登录功能模块可以正常使用用例1.输入格式正确的用户名和正确的密码,验证是否登录成功;2.输入格式正确的用户名和不正确的密码
咖 啡加剁椒
·
2024-02-02 01:42
软件测试
python
selenium
开发语言
软件测试
功能测试
自动化测试
程序人生
lr
参数化
lr
参数化
:1.按迭代依次2.每出现一次,如一个迭代出现了两次,那么就连续用到两个变量3.uniq每个变量值只出现一次4.once无论怎么执行,都只显示同一个变量值
sanford_eb20
·
2024-02-02 00:43
【Jenkins】配置及使用|
参数化
|邮件|源码|报表|乱码
目录一、Jenkins二、Jenkins环境搭建1、下载所需的软件包2、部署步骤3、其他三、Jenkins全局设置(一)ManageJenkins——Tools系统管理->全局工具配置分别配置JDK、Maven、Allure、Git,可以配置路径或者直接选择版本安装1、jdk配置2、maven配置3、AllureCommandline4、Git配置(二)ManageJenkins->SystemJ
墨撕酒家
·
2024-02-01 23:16
jenkins
jenkins
ci/cd
运维
今日arXiv最热NLP大模型论文:伯克利&DeepMind联合研究,RaLMSpec让检索增强LLM速度提升2-7倍!
引言:知识密集型NLP任务中的挑战与RaLM的潜力在知识密集型自然语言处理(NLP)任务中,传统的大语言模型面临着将海量知识编码进全
参数化
模型的巨大挑战。
夕小瑶
·
2024-02-01 22:29
自然语言处理
人工智能
Python+Requests+Pytest+Excel+Allure 接口自动化测试项目实战【框架之间的对比】
--------
UnitTest
框架和PyTest框架的简单认识对比与项目实战--------定义:
Unittest
是Python标准库中自带的单元测试框架,
Unittest
有时候也被称为PyUnit,
爱学习的执念
·
2024-02-01 20:46
软件测试
技术分享
python
pytest
excel
python技术栈之单元测试中mock的使用
unittest
是python内置的单元测试库,在做接口测试时,如果开发的接口未开发出来,我们如果想要测试接口联调,又不能干等着,这时可以使用
unittest
.mock模拟接口
爱学习的执念
·
2024-02-01 20:14
软件测试
技术分享
python
单元测试
log4j
python 防止sql注入
python防止sql注入在Python中防止SQL注入有以下几种实现方法:1、使用
参数化
查询(PreparedStatements):这是最常用和推荐的方法。
=(^.^)=哈哈哈
·
2024-02-01 19:50
python
sql
开发语言
Java防止注入常用方法
Java防止注入在Java中,可以通过使用
参数化
查询或者预编译语句来防止SQL注入。
=(^.^)=哈哈哈
·
2024-02-01 19:50
java
数据库
sql
Golang防止注入常用方法
Golang防止注入常用方法在Golang中,可以通过使用
参数化
查询或者ORM(对象关系映射)来防止SQL注入。1、
参数化
查询:当构建SQL语句时,将变量作为参数传递而不直接拼接到字符串中。
=(^.^)=哈哈哈
·
2024-02-01 19:18
golang
开发语言
后端
python+selenium+
unittest
实现自动登录
fromseleniumimportwebdriverimport
unittest
importtimeclassHomePageLogin(
unittest
.TestCase):defsetUp(self
xiaoxiaozhang11
·
2024-02-01 11:07
selenium
xpath
unittest
Python+Selenium+
Unittest
之selenium13--WebDriver操作方法3-鼠标操作2
这篇说下ActionChains里常用的几种鼠标操作的方法。ActionChains常用的鼠标操作方法click()鼠标左键单击double_click()鼠标左键双击context_click()鼠标右键单击move_to_element()鼠标移动到某个元素上(鼠标悬浮操作)click_and_hold()点击鼠标左键,不松开drag_and_drop()拖拽到某个元素然后松开drag_and
刘阿童木
·
2024-02-01 11:06
web自动化
python
selenium
Python+Selenium+
Unittest
之selenium14--WebDriver操作方法4-键盘操作
在自动化中除了能模拟鼠标的操作外,也需要模拟键盘的操作,比如复制、粘贴、删除等等,这时候就可以用selenium的Keys库,可以看到截图中里的都是Keys的方法,下面说下常用的几个操作方法。常用的键盘操作方法键盘方法对应的键盘上的按键Keys.ENTER回车键Keys.TABTab键Keys.SHIFTShift键Keys.CONTROLCtrl键Keys.ALTAlt键Keys.SPACE空格
刘阿童木
·
2024-02-01 11:06
python
selenium
Python+Selenium+
unittest
自动化测试框架
什么是自动化测试呢?自动化测试的本质就是把手工测试的一系列动作通过自动化的形式实现。什么情况下需要用自动化测试呢?1、需求不会频繁变动因为需求频繁变动,页面就会频繁变动,可能刚写好测试脚本就立马要修改了。2、UI比较稳定UI频繁变动,功能和控件就会变动,需要不断调试脚本。3、项目周期较长项目周期长,整个UI自动化覆盖率就会较高,会有充分的时间去填充自动化测试场景。搭建自动化测试框架1、case:测
5农50
·
2024-02-01 11:06
python
selenium
pycharm
Python+Selenium+
Unittest
之selenium1--环境搭建
对于学习一个新东西来说,最开始就是要搭建环境了,关于python的环境搭建这里就不说了,主要说下selenium的环境搭建相关内容和安装过程中可能遇到的坑,细节不太一致的可以自行百度解决下,本章所使用的版本为python3.9+selenium3.10.0。首先是要下载selenium,我采用的是使用pip的方法进行安装selenium,网上推荐的也是使用这种办法来进行安装,关于pip相关的这里就
刘阿童木
·
2024-02-01 11:36
web自动化
python
自动化
Python+selenium 【第七章】
Unittest
学习
Python+selenium【第七章】
Unittest
学习什么是
Unittest
使用
unittest
前需要熟悉该框架的五个概念
unittest
基本使用步骤
unittest
常用断言介绍断言示例代码
unittest
罐装七喜
·
2024-02-01 11:05
Python-UI自动化
python
selenium
单元测试
Python+Selenium+
unittest
demo
代码如下:#coding=utf-8importtimeimport
unittest
fromseleniumimportwebdriverclassBaiduSearch(
unittest
.TestCase
·
2024-02-01 11:35
Python
软件测试
python
自动化
Python+Selenium+
Unittest
+HTMLTestRunner线性自动化框架实战详细教程
大部分公司项目管理工具都为禅道,此篇以禅道登录进行举例一、创建包和目录1、common:存放公共方法,如测试执行前的操作(打开浏览器)、测试执行后的操作(关闭浏览器)、登录等2、config:一般用于存放ini配置文件3、report:用于存放HTML测试报告4、test_cases:测试用例目录5、run_all.py:用于执行所有测试用例的文件二、各目录的编写方法1、首先编写单独的测试用例,确
我是丸子丫
·
2024-02-01 11:31
Python
selenium
python
selenium
自动化
ui
Python+Selenium+
Unittest
之selenium15--等待时间
在正常的自动化过程中,如果整篇代码中没有加等待时间的话,有时候可能页面跳转或者还没开始点击就执行到下一个流程了,这时候因为页面没有加载完毕,所以有可能会导致找不到对应的元素而报错,因此我们需要在整个代码流程中间合适的位置加上等待时间,使其等待页面加载完毕后,在进行后续代码流程。Selenium中有三种等待方式,分别为:强制等待、隐式等待、显示等待。1、强制等待。强制等待顾名思义就是按着设置的等待时
刘阿童木
·
2024-02-01 11:00
selenium
测试工具
java基础面试题:Java 泛型了解么?什么是类型擦除?介绍一下常用的通配符?
Java泛型是一种在编译时提供类型安全性的机制,允许在定义类、接口和方法时使用
参数化
类型。通过使用泛型,可以在编译时检查和保证程序在类型方面的正确性,并提供更好的代码重用性和可读性。
追梦者1
·
2024-02-01 11:59
java
开发语言
OceanBase与新加坡南洋理工大学合作,推进机器学习与数据库技术融合
数据库应用程序广泛使用
参数化
查询
CSDN云计算
·
2024-02-01 10:41
oceanbase
机器学习
数据库
Pycharm 关闭/退出烦人的Pytest模式
如何解决:1打开File-Settings(图片是新版界面,旧版同样操作)2Tools中的PythonIntegratedTools在Testing里选择
Unittest
s就好了
X_Cosmic
·
2024-02-01 10:22
pycharm
pytest
ide
10分钟搞懂,Python接口自动化测试-接口依赖-实战教程
未登录状态下,直接请求充值接口的异常场景:import
unittest
importrequestsclassTestRecharge(
unittest
.TestCase):de
程序员雷子
·
2024-01-31 21:39
jmeter
单元测试
自动化
selenium
测试工具
功能测试
测试用例
C#,洛布数(Lobb Number)的计算方法与源代码
Lobb数由两个非负整数m和n
参数化
,其中n>=m>=0。
深度混淆
·
2024-01-31 20:56
C#算法演义
Algorithm
Recipes
c#
算法
pytest测试框架
自动化测试中,需要使用多套测试数据实现用例的
参数化
,有没有更便捷的方式?
jardonwang1
·
2024-01-31 20:34
pytest
pycharm
ide
在主流测试框架中,相比于
Unittest
,Pytest才是yyds
而说起Python单元测试框架,那必然会提及
unitTest
和Pytest。几乎每一个测试人,都接触过这其中一种,或者二者都有过接触。那问题来了,这两种主流框架之间到底有什么区别和特点?
测试大大怪
·
2024-01-31 20:04
面试
职场和发展
软件测试
功能测试
自动化测试
项目-Java-Junit-Lua
文章目录参考内容接口的本质基础HTTP接口Junit5基础内容测试注解断言前置条件嵌套测试
参数化
测试项目学习与JUnit4的显著区别Lua概述参考内容testNG教程:https://zhuanlan.zhihu.com
LXMXHJ
·
2024-01-31 16:20
java学习
java
junit
开发语言
【python】在python中使用单元测试
unittest
在python中使用单元测试
unittest
大家好,欢迎来到我的技术乐园!今天,我们将一起踏入Python单元测试的奇妙旅程,探索这个让我们的代码更可靠、更强壮的令人愉快的世界。
babybin
·
2024-01-31 15:37
Python
python
开发语言
Pytest测试用例
参数化
@pytest.mark.parametrize('参数名1,参数名2...参数n',[(参数名1_data1,参数名2_data1...参数名n_data1),(参数名1_data2,参数名2_data2...参数名n_data2)])场景:定义一个登录函数test_login,传入参数为name,password,需要用多个账号去测试登录功能#test_mod6.pyimportpytest@
老孟说禅
·
2024-01-31 14:40
学习python
pytest
测试用例
用katalon解决接口/自动化测试拦路虎--
参数化
不管是做接口测试还是做自动化测试,
参数化
肯定是一个绕不过去的坎。因为我们要考虑到多个接口都使用相同参数的问题。所以,本文将讲述一下katalon是如何进行
参数化
的。
咖啡 加剁椒
·
2024-01-31 13:28
软件测试
压力测试
软件测试
自动化测试
功能测试
程序人生
职场和发展
激活函数
SigmoidtanhReluRelu6LeakyRely
参数化
Relu
Mr_Stark的小提莫
·
2024-01-31 07:22
【测试运维】接口测试各知识md文档学习笔记第1篇(已分享,附代码)
熟悉Jmeter工具组成,
参数化
、集合点、关联、断言、数据库,属性管理器及逻辑控制器,项目实战(接口功能脚本、自动化脚本、性能脚本)。
程序员一诺
·
2024-01-31 06:43
python笔记
测试
运维
学习
笔记
Kotlin快速入门系列8
泛型,即"
参数化
类型",将类型
参数化
,可以用在类,接口,方法上。可以为类型安全提供保证,消除类型强转的烦恼。
左大星
·
2024-01-31 05:18
kotlin
开发语言
android
【Python自动化测试】如何才能让用例自动运行完之后,生成一张直观可看易懂的测试报告呢?
小编使用的是
unittest
的一个扩展HTMLTestRunner环境准备使用之前,我们需要下载HTMLTestRunner.py文件点击HTMLTestRunner后进入的是一个写满代码的网页,小编推荐操作
美团程序员
·
2024-01-31 05:31
软件测试
技术分享
自动化测试
python
开发语言
JAVA使用反射机制获取Record类型的类对象判断是否是Record类型并取出所有的Component组件------JAVA
packagecom.example.demo;importorg.junit.Test;importjava.lang.reflect.RecordComponent;importjava.util.ArrayList;/***
Unittest
forsimpleApp
旧约Alatus
·
2024-01-31 04:50
JAVA
java
maven
xml
list
junit
后端
mybatis
机器学习复习(5)——激活函数
LeakyRelu激活函数Swish激活函数激活函数分类激活函数可以分为两大类:饱和激活函数:sigmoid、tanh非饱和激活函数:ReLU、LeakyRelu、ELU【指数线性单元】、PReLU【
参数化
的
不会写代码!!
·
2024-01-31 04:47
人工智能
机器学习复习
机器学习算法
机器学习
深度学习
人工智能
伯克利&DeepMind联合研究,RaLMSpec让检索增强LLM速度提升2-7倍!
引言:知识密集型NLP任务中的挑战与RaLM的潜力在知识密集型自然语言处理(NLP)任务中,传统的大语言模型面临着将海量知识编码进全
参数化
模型的巨大挑战。
AI知识图谱大本营
·
2024-01-31 02:20
大模型
人工智能
Command模式(命令模式)
介绍意图:将一个请求封装成一个对象,从而使您可以用不同的请求对客户进行
参数化
。
涅槃快乐是金
·
2024-01-30 19:29
【webrtc】m98 : vs2019 直接构建webrtc及moduletest工程 2
字数有限制,我们继续【webrtc】m98:vs2019直接构建webrtc及unitest工程1modules_
unittest
s构建Buildstarted...1>------Buildstarted
等风来不如迎风去
·
2024-01-30 14:30
WebRTC入门与实战
webrtc
【如何学习python自动化测试】—— 浏览器驱动的安装 以及 如何更新driver
浏览器驱动的安装以及如何更新driver2.页面元素定位3.时间等待4.浏览器操作5.鼠标键盘操作6.多层窗口定位7.警告框处理8.Cookie处理9.expected_conditions10.Python的
unittest
ZShiJ
·
2024-01-30 14:48
软件测试
Python
学习
python
自动化
Angular如何对包含了HTTP请求的服务类进行单元测试
Github这个文件夹下面:https://github.com/wangzixi-diablo/angular-sandbox/blob/master/src/app/ngrxdemo/service/
unittest
-study
JerryWang_汪子熙
·
2024-01-30 14:45
Java 泛型
为什么使用泛型泛型就是“
参数化
类型”,就是把类型当作参数传递对于为什么要使用泛型,我们先来举几个栗子1:publicintadd(inta,intb){returna+b;}publicdoubleadd
Mr_panmin
·
2024-01-30 11:13
creo老是卡住怎么办?如何解决Creo卡顿问题
Creo是整合了PTC公司的三个软件Pro/Engineer的
参数化
技术、CoCreate的直接建模技术和ProductView的三维可视化技术的新型CAD设计软件包,是PTC公司闪电计划所推出的第一个产品
赞奇超高清设计师云工作站
·
2024-01-30 09:21
3d设计
云工作站
云服务
creo
工业仿真
3d设计
上一页
2
3
4
5
6
7
8
9
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他